About Premier Homecare Of Indiana
Premier Homecare of Indiana has been serving Indianapolis families since 2014. The agency is Medicare certified and offers six services: skilled nursing, physical therapy, occupational therapy, speech-language pathology, medical social services, and home health aide care. They are located at 8455 Keystone Crossing and can be reached at (317) 536-1731.

Local context
Indianapolis has 29 Medicare-certified home health agencies serving the community. The average rating across these agencies is 2.97 stars out of 5. Like all Medicare-certified providers, Premier Homecare of Indiana must meet federal requirements to maintain their certification.
